Obituary: Tara Rae Warren

Aug. 11, 1970 – Feb. 28, 2019 

Tara Rae Warren, 48, of Sturgeon Bay died at Door County Medical Center in Sturgeon Bay.

She was born in Madison, the daughter of the late Robert Willis Warren and Laverne Dorothy (Voagen) Warren. Tara graduated from Homestead High School in Mequon in 1989. She worked in food service and was a member of Sturgeon Bay United Methodist Church.

Tara enjoyed swimming, bowling and traveling. She liked horses, ’80s music and movies — especially Star Wars and Grease. Her favorite color was purple, and she was always one to greet others around her. Tara loved her family very much.

She will be missed by her sister-in-law and guardian, Kathy Warren; sister, Cheryl (F. James) Sensenbrenner; two brothers, Gregg (Mary Kay) Warren and Lyle Warren; aunts and uncles; cousins; nieces and nephews; dear friend and caretaker, Julie Pflieger; and friends.

Tara was preceded in death by her parents; sister Treiva Warren Livesey; brother Iver Warren (who passed away two days prior); and other relatives.

Tara’s and Iver’s lives were honored, together, with a funeral service held on Sunday, March 3, at Sturgeon Bay United Methodist Church, with Pastor David Leistra officiating. They will be laid to rest by family in Mount Olive Cemetery.
